Output 3ec03c75bfaf0523853683b9317ff19b264a7db647fc23fd68fa90d0965114fb:2

value
351416791
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 139e6c4c71c4dcd62af3079236960358fb85f048 OP_EQUALVERIFY OP_CHECKSIG
address
12njd56jm4LRfPxjTqb1aGA13soMXhYbBg
transaction
3ec03c75bfaf0523853683b9317ff19b264a7db647fc23fd68fa90d0965114fb
spent
true